The Hidden Cost of Manual Bookkeeping in Auto Repair Shops

Most small auto repair shop owners spend hours each week transferring data manually between their shop management software and their accounting system. Invoices, payments, parts costs, and labor charges all require re-entry. This process wastes time and creates errors. A missed invoice or an incorrectly recorded payment creates reconciliation problems that take even longer to untangle. QuickBooks integration eliminates this by syncing data automatically between both systems. How does QuickBooks integration work with auto repair shop software?

QuickBooks integration creates a direct connection between your shop management software and QuickBooks. When you create an invoice, record a payment, or log a parts expense in your shop software, that data syncs to QuickBooks automatically. This eliminates duplicate data entry, reduces accounting errors, and keeps your books current without any manual effort.

What QuickBooks Integration Automates for Auto Repair Shops

  • Invoice creation and sync from shop management software to QuickBooks in real time
  • Payment recording across both platforms simultaneously upon confirmation
  • Parts and labor cost tracking without manual ledger entry
  • Customer account balances and payment history synchronization
  • Sales tax recording including GST/HST for Canadian shops
  • Technician hours export for streamlined payroll processing
  • Profit and loss reporting by job type or service category
  • Accounts receivable tracking for outstanding and overdue balances

The Real Cost of Not Integrating Your Shop and Accounting Systems

A shop owner spending two hours per week on manual bookkeeping loses over 100 hours per year to that task alone. Errors compound the problem further. An invoice entered incorrectly in two places creates a discrepancy that surfaces during tax season or a CRA audit at the worst possible time. Integration converts this ongoing risk into a straightforward, automated process that runs in the background while you run your shop. How to Set Up QuickBooks Integration for Your Auto Repair Shop

Check whether your shop management platform has a native QuickBooks integration before looking elsewhere. Tekmetric, AutoLeap, Shop-Ware, and Mitchell 1 all offer direct connections to QuickBooks Online. For platforms without native integration, tools like Zapier can bridge the gap. Work with your accountant to map your chart of accounts correctly before activating the sync. Run both systems in parallel for the first 30 days to catch discrepancies before fully relying on the integration. Frequently Asked Questions

Which auto repair shop software integrates with QuickBooks?

Tekmetric, AutoLeap, Shop-Ware, Mitchell 1, and Protractor all offer QuickBooks integration. Confirm whether the integration supports QuickBooks Online or QuickBooks Desktop before committing, as functionality differs meaningfully between the two versions.

Does QuickBooks integration work for Canadian shops using QuickBooks Canada?

Yes. Many shop management platforms support QuickBooks Canada. Confirm that your shop software handles GST/HST tax categories correctly before activating the sync. Test several invoices manually to verify that tax line items transfer accurately to your QuickBooks Canada file.

Can I sync historical transaction data when setting up the integration?

It depends on the platform. Some integrations sync only new transactions from the activation date forward. Others support historical data import. Ask your software vendor about historical sync options and any limitations before going live.

Will QuickBooks integration replace my accountant?

No. Integration automates data entry, not accounting judgment or financial decisions. Your accountant still reviews, categorizes, and files your financials. The difference is they receive clean and current data instead of manually compiled spreadsheets, which saves their time and reduces your accounting fees.
